What's The Definition Of Barbarism?
barbarism
uncountable noun: If you refer to someone's behaviour as barbarism, you strongly disapprove of it because you think that it is extremely cruel or uncivilized. barbarism in American English the use of words and expressions not standard in a language noun: a barbarous or uncivilized state or condition barbarism in British English noun: a brutal, coarse, or ignorant act |
